how to make the most money on spark,How to Make the Most Money on Spark

how to make the most money on spark,How to Make the Most Money on Spark

How to Make the Most Money on Spark

Are you looking to maximize your earnings on Spark? Whether you’re a beginner or an experienced user, there are numerous strategies you can employ to boost your income. In this article, we’ll explore various dimensions to help you make the most money on Spark.

Understanding Spark

how to make the most money on spark,How to Make the Most Money on Spark

Before diving into the money-making strategies, it’s crucial to have a clear understanding of Spark. Spark is a widely-used distributed computing system that provides an interface for programming entire clusters with implicit data parallelism and fault tolerance. It’s designed to handle large-scale data processing tasks efficiently.

Optimizing Your Spark Setup

One of the key factors in maximizing your earnings on Spark is optimizing your setup. Here are some tips to help you get started:

  • Choose the right hardware: Ensure your Spark cluster is running on high-performance hardware to handle large-scale data processing tasks efficiently.

  • Optimize your Spark configuration: Tune your Spark configuration settings to match your specific workload and hardware capabilities.

  • Use efficient data formats: Utilize efficient data formats like Parquet or ORC to reduce disk I/O and improve processing speed.

Developing High-Performance Spark Applications

Developing high-performance Spark applications is essential for maximizing your earnings. Here are some tips to help you achieve this:

  • Understand Spark’s data processing model: Familiarize yourself with Spark’s data processing model, including transformations and actions, to write efficient code.

  • Use Spark’s built-in functions and libraries: Leverage Spark’s extensive library of built-in functions and libraries to simplify your code and improve performance.

  • Optimize your code: Profile your code to identify bottlenecks and optimize your code accordingly.

Monetizing Your Spark Skills

Once you’ve honed your Spark skills, there are several ways to monetize them:

  • Freelancing: Offer your Spark expertise to clients who need help with data processing tasks.

  • Consulting: Provide consulting services to organizations looking to implement or optimize their Spark infrastructure.

  • Developing custom solutions: Create custom Spark-based solutions for clients with specific data processing needs.

Joining Spark Communities

Joining Spark communities can help you stay updated with the latest trends and best practices in Spark. Here are some communities you can join:

  • Apache Spark mailing list: Subscribe to the Apache Spark mailing list to stay informed about the latest updates and discussions.

  • Stack Overflow: Participate in Spark-related discussions on Stack Overflow to learn from and help others.

  • LinkedIn groups: Join LinkedIn groups focused on Spark to network with other professionals and share your knowledge.

Case Studies

Here are some case studies showcasing how individuals and organizations have made money on Spark:

Company Industry Spark Application Revenue Generated
Netflix Entertainment Recommendation engine $1 billion
Capital One Finance Data analytics $100 million
IBM Technology Data processing $500 million

Conclusion

By optimizing your Spark setup, developing high-performance applications, and monetizing your skills, you can make the most money on Spark. Remember to stay updated with the latest trends and join relevant communities to enhance your knowledge and network. With dedication and perseverance, you can achieve significant success in the world of Spark.